Script Welef 10 is a very light, narrow, low contrast, italic, short x-height font.

A delicate formal script with a monoline feel and a consistent rightward slant. Letterforms are built from slender, continuous strokes with generous entry and exit terminals, frequent loops, and occasional extended swashes, especially in capitals. Curves are smooth and rounded, counters are open, and spacing stays even, giving lines a calm, flowing rhythm. Numerals follow the same light, cursive construction with modest flourishes and a handwritten continuity.
This font works best in short to medium-length settings where its swashy capitals and fine strokes can be appreciated—wedding suites, invitations, greeting cards, boutique branding, and premium packaging. It can also serve as a secondary accent in editorial or social graphics when paired with a restrained serif or sans for body copy.
The overall tone is graceful and polite, with a romantic, old-world charm. Its light touch and looping capitals suggest formality and care, suited to designs that want a gentle, sophisticated voice rather than bold emphasis.
The design appears intended to evoke classic penmanship in a polished, display-friendly script, balancing legibility with decorative loops and refined terminals. It aims to provide a light, graceful signature-like texture for formal, celebratory, or heritage-leaning typography.
Capitals are noticeably more ornate than the lowercase, with larger proportions and pronounced looped strokes that create decorative focal points. Descenders and ascenders are long and clean, contributing to an airy texture in running text while keeping the baseline flow smooth.
